Now taking form on Deer Valley® Resort’s eastern boundary, just below the Sultan Lift, is Mayflower Mountain Resort. As North America’s first new mountain ski resort since 1980, this 6,800-acre parcel sits on the west side of Highway 40 overlooking the Jordanelle Reservoir.
